Textrix is a rich-text publishing editor inspired by Medium — built for the modern web. Use it for blogs, newsletters, writing platforms, real-time collaboration, or as a beautiful, ready-to-use editor in your app.

Unlike most editors, Textrix lets you write, edit, and publish in one place!, Generate a static HTML article or blog post from document that look exactly like they did in the editor, making it truly WYSIWYG (what you see is what you get), this will result in faster load times, better SEO, and higher search rankings.

Built for developers and writers, Builds with the flexible ProseMirror library.

Features

  • 🚀 Fast & Lightweight: Optimized to handle large documents with smooth performance.
  • 🎨 Customizable: Plugin-based architecture easy for customization.
  • 🧠 AI Autocomplete (Coming Soon): Add AI to your editor
  • 📝 Rich Media Support: Embed images, videos, websites, tooltips, popups, and more.
  • ⌨️ Markdown Support: Markdown formatting and shortcuts.
  • 🔄 Live Collaboration: Real-time editing, Version history, and backend sync.
  • 🌍 Multi-Language Ready: Localization, right-to-left (RTL) support.
  • 📦 Tree-shakeable: Bundle only the features you need.
  • 🌍 Framework-Agnostic: use it with React, Vue, Svelte, Vanilla JS, and more.
